Martyr in an Israeli Airstrike on Southern Lebanon
SadaNews - A person was martyred today, Friday, in the town of Aita al-Shaab in southern Lebanon, as a result of an airstrike by the Israeli occupation that targeted the vicinity of a house in the town.
The Lebanese Ministry of Health announced in a statement that an Israeli strike using a drone on the town of Aita al-Shaab, in the district of Bint Jbeil, resulted in a martyr.
Earlier, the Lebanese news agency reported that the Israeli airstrike targeted the vicinity of a house in the Abu Laban neighborhood of the town of Aita al-Shaab, with no further details provided.
